MEM new rates for Long Distance Service, effective May
25th and based upon air -line mileage, correct inequalities
in the old schedule and embody both increased and de-
creased charges.
Following is a comparison of old and new rates for a
3 -minute talk to points most frequently called by local sub-
scribers:

The hours during u hich reduced Long Distance. rotes (night rates)
are in effect are now
From 8.30 p.in. to 11.30 p.tn., 60 per cent of day rate
From 11.30 p.m. to 6 a.nl., 40 per cent of day rake
Night rules are based on Standard Tinge
LOCAL StE VICE
Rates for local service to present subscribers will be increased ten
per cent, effective from July 1st next.
Applicants for service will be charged at the increased rates, from
May 25th.
Every ,Bell Telephone is a Lone Distance Station
The ell Telephone. Co. =c.If Ca oda
